"A Great Collection"

This is a great collection of the first two God of War games. I have reviewed each of them separately, so I won't delve into each of those for this review. Instead, I'll cover what is done with these updated versions and how it enhances or takes away from the experience of each.

Fortunately, not much is messed with for these titles. While there isn't a whole slew of bonus content for either game that wasn't already included with the original disks, both games are upgraded to a 720p resolution at 60 frames per second. This helps a bunch with the fluidity of fighting and the smoothness of in-game cutscenes and setpieces.

Overall, for the combination of both games and some graphical enhancements, I say this collection is a bit greater than the sum of its parts. Therefore it gets a point boost for combining these games as an upgraded package at a reasonable price. It's much better to play these games in HD than at SD separately, and if you are able to find this collection at a reasonable price I would say go ahead and pull the trigger on it. I can Recommend this collection and its enhancements to fans of the originals or newcomers to the series, as it is one of the definitive ways to play these games currently.
